How tax works on Galleria (Whop confirmed)
- Galleria checkout = Whop hosted payment screen (opens from the product page).
- Sellers set a list price on the product card. Buyers choose their country before paying.
- VAT and sales tax are calculated automatically from the buyer’s location — EU buyers typically see VAT; many other countries do not.
- List prices are VAT-inclusive: the payment screen shows the final total for that buyer before they pay (+ shipping on physical items).
- You do not need to turn on VAT or change tax settings in Whop for Galleria — checkout handles it.
- Sellers: open Payments Hub → finish verification → set list prices → sell.
- You still own income tax on earnings and import customs paperwork on physical international orders.

Also your responsibility
- Income tax & reporting on your earnings — Seller Agreement.
- Physical goods — shipping quoted separately; the marketplace fee applies to the product price only.
- International physical orders — import customs/duties are buyer/seller responsibility.
- Collabs & agency splits — based on product subtotal after the marketplace fee, not tax lines.
